ICT innovators receive BICTA prizes

KUALA Belait’s Chung Hwa Middle School’s ‘Chemistry Flash Education’, Teleconsuft’s ‘TeleGis’, Maktab Teknik Sultan Saiful Rijal’s ‘Sports Day System’, Mars Enterprise’s ‘Bru-link e-custom’ and TT mobile’s ‘Mobile Coupon’ all walked away with first prize cheques from their respective categories, yesterday afternoon, during the 2009 Brunei ICT Awards at the Empire Hotel and Country Club.

A total of 17 entries were received since the competition commenced in June under five categories: Secondary Student Project, Tertiary Student Project, e-Logistics and Supply Chain Management, Start-up and General.

According to Dr Yong Chee Tuan, Chairman of BICTA 2009, the most challenging part of the competition was to bring together the representatives of industry experts, academics and government officers and successful entrepreneurs to decide on the criteria for the judging and the judging of the innovations themselves.
“The participants of the competition were judged based on their uniqueness, functionalities and features, quality and application technology, market potential, proof of concept and presentation of products,” he added.

BICTA is a component of the Asia Pacific Info-Communication Technology Awards (APICTA) whose vision is to widen the influence of ICT industry in the Asian region. The main objective of BICTA is to stimulate innovation and creativity in the local ICT industry amongst individuals, SMEs and education institutions as well as to be a benchmark for local companies to compete amongst each other for a chance to participate in the annually held APICTA competition.

There were no second place winners in this year’s competition “because they did not meet APICTA’s marking standard”, it said in a statement.

The first and third place winners were presented with their trophies and cheques by the Minister of Communications, Pehin Orang Kaya Seri Kerna Dato Seri Setia Haji Abu Bakar bin Haji Apong.
The winners will represent Brunei in the 2009 Asia Pacific ICT Awards (APICTA) to be held in Melbourne, Australia, later this year.
